Low Down Payment and No Deposit Insurance
Many people struggle with the upfront costs of car insurance. Fortunately, some companies offer policies with low down payments or even no deposit required. These options can make insurance more accessible, especially for those on a tight budget. Be sure to ask about these options when requesting quotes.
Insurance Solutions for Specific Needs
- Students, Insurance for students can be particularly expensive due to their inexperience on the road. Look for student discounts or consider being added to a parent’s policy to lower costs.
- Drivers With a Bad Credit History, A poor credit score can significantly impact your insurance rates. Some insurers specialize in providing coverage for drivers with bad credit, so it’s worth seeking them out.
- New Drivers, As a new driver, you’re considered a higher risk due to your lack of experience. Taking a defensive driving course can sometimes help lower your premiums.

Insurance Rates by US Region
Car insurance rates vary significantly by region. Factors like population density, accident rates, and state regulations all play a role. Factors Affecting Insurance Costs
Several factors influence the cost of your car insurance policy,
- Age, Younger drivers typically pay more for insurance due to their higher accident risk.
- Credit Rating, As mentioned earlier, a good credit score can lead to lower premiums.
- Type of Car, The make and model of your vehicle affect insurance costs. Expensive cars and those prone to theft generally have higher premiums.
- Driving History, A clean driving record is essential for obtaining affordable insurance. Accidents and traffic violations, including DUI/DWI convictions, can significantly increase your rates.
Considerations for Unique Situations
- Temporary Insurance, If you only need insurance for a short period, such as for a road trip or when borrowing a car, temporary insurance policies can be a cost-effective option.
- Insurance Without a License, While it’s generally not possible to obtain car insurance without a valid driver’s license, there might be limited exceptions in certain circumstances. For example, if you own a car but don’t drive it yourself, you may need a non-driver insurance policy.
- Pay-Per-Mile Programs, For drivers who don’t drive frequently, pay-per-mile insurance programs can offer significant savings. These programs track your mileage and charge you based on how much you drive.
Tips for Lowering Your Car Insurance Costs
- Increase Your Deductible, Choosing a higher deductible can lower your monthly premiums, but make sure you can afford to pay the deductible if you need to file a claim.
- Bundle Your Insurance, Many insurers offer discounts for bundling your car insurance with other policies, such as homeowners or renters insurance.
- Maintain a Good Driving Record, Avoiding accidents and traffic violations is the best way to keep your insurance rates low.
- Review Your Coverage Regularly, As your circumstances change, your insurance needs may also change. Review your coverage annually to ensure you have the right protection at the best price.
- Enhance Vehicle Safety, Installing anti-theft devices or features that improve vehicle safety can sometimes result in discounts.
